1. Terracotta Color Palettes

is the watchward: the earthy color scheme that’s inspired by the rich, reddish-brown tones

of terracotta clay. It includes shades of deep red, orange, and brown, and it’s perfect for a fall

or rustic-themed wedding. It is really suitable for a cozy, romantic celebration.

It also looks amazing against natural settings, like outdoor gardens or rustic barns,

and it pairs well with natural materials like wood, stone, and greenery.

2. Retro-Inspired Wedding Cakes

It’s a cake that’s inspired by the styles and trends of a specific era, like the 50s or 60s.

They often have fun, retro-inspired details like bold colors, patterns, and shapes.

3. Wedding Maximalism

As opposed to the “less is more” design approach, maximalist weddings embrace doing more,

more, more! Lots of colors, lots of patterns, and lots of textures!

This could be just used for the reception space or the ceremony to different the two spaces –

or it could be the overall theme of the wedding day!
